Dimagi is a Social Enterprise, Benefit Corporation, and Tech company focused on making an impact globally. Our product, CommCare, assists some of the world's most underserved and hard-to-reach communities in health, agriculture, education, and beyond through innovative digital data management systems. Our team of incredibly dedicated staff work towards our mission of creating an impact in the world from our four global offices. Our technology is now used around the world in more than 60 countries. What You'll Do :

- Own and execute the Sales Development efforts in the lead qualifying stage of the process including :

- Research new contacts at ideal prospective organizations (outbound leads)

- Identify interesting possible new leads by looking at their activities with our website, product, and emails and by answering their questions on our Live Chat tool.

- Schedule meetings/calls & qualify leads by evaluating their needs

- Create revenue opportunities for Account Executives

- Invest time corresponding and engaging with senior leaders of large businesses - on the phone, by email, via WebEx, and through social media outreach

- Evangelize Dimagi's brand and offering, and assist clients with finding the best solution to fit their need

- Manage and monitor your work using Salesforce and other sales tools and technologies

- Gather information about our users and their experience with our product and disseminate this insight back to the rest of the Growth team

- Proactively identify ways to improve the qualifying part of the Sales process to maximize the revenue pipeline

- Report to the Growth team on key outcomes and key sales metrics
